1Definition

Global Governance for AI Ethics is a theoretical framework aimed at establishing international agreements, standards, and oversight mechanisms to ensure the responsible and ethical use of artificial intelligence technologies.

2Problem It Solves

The lack of uniform global standards for ethical AI use leads to inconsistent application of best practices across different jurisdictions, potentially resulting in unethical uses of AI that could harm individuals or society at large.

4How It Works

This involves creating multilateral frameworks that can be adopted by governments, organizations, and businesses worldwide. These frameworks set guidelines on data privacy, transparency, bias mitigation, accountability, and other ethical considerations in AI development and deployment.

7Build Process

The build process involves extensive consultation with stakeholders from various sectors including government, industry, academia, and civil society to develop consensus on ethical guidelines. These guidelines are then formalized into international agreements or standards.

14Glossary
AI Ethics
The study of ethical issues related to artificial intelligence, including concerns about bias, privacy, accountability, and the impact on society.
Global Governance
A system of international cooperation and regulation aimed at addressing global challenges through collective action among nations.
